Celebrating the Chinese Cultural Heritage explores Chinese festival performances and parades in London’s Chinese New Year celebrations, including Dragon Dance, Lion Dance, Ying Ge Dance, and Hanfu Parade. It preserves and shares cultural traditions through collective memory connecting past, present, and future.
